Mexican President Vows to Influence American Elections |
2022-06-08 |
[OffthePress] Mexican President Andrés Manuel López Obrador expressed he would be willing to influence the rhetoric surrounding the U.S. midterm elections if any candidate were to speak poorly about Mexicans, while speaking on his desire about the U.S. reforming its immigration system. "We are not going to allow Mexican migrants to be questioned in campaigns to supposedly win votes, we do not accept xenophobia, we do not accept racism," he said at a May 20 press conference, referencing the U.S. November elections. He noted that his policy is "non-intervention and self-determination." |
